2000–2020 Market Street
Castro (Eureka Valley) · San Francisco, CA 94114
-
1905
The block held a Japanese nursery of two greenhouses, bunkhouses, a tankhouse, stables and a large shed, run on land rented from the Spring Valley Water Company by Y. Fujioka, proprietor of The Fuji Florist Shop and the largest Japanese florist then working in San Francisco. It was watered from Sans Souci Creek.
-
1906
Refugees from the earthquake put up tents and wooden shanties on the vacant parcel, at the foot of Clinton Mound.
-
August 12, 1943
The nation's first municipal farmers' market opened on the 72,000 square-foot lot, organised by John G. Bruncato of the San Francisco Victory Garden Council to connect Bay Area farmers with city buyers after wartime disrupted produce distribution. Over a thousand people came the first day; within three days managers estimated 50,000 residents had bought from the 100 farmers selling there. The market moved to Alemany Boulevard in the late 1940s.
-
1953
Safeway opened here, originally in the Late Moderne style; the statement calls it one of the neighborhood's most important landmarks despite sitting just outside the survey area, and notes it has been incrementally remodelled and greatly expanded since.
